After 12th, I am doing 2.5 years Diploma course in animation, should I go for graduation as a regular or correspondence course?

If you have recently started doing Diploma, then you can opt for doing graduation through distance mode along with Diploma. You will complete both at around same time. Choose a less demanding course like BA to lower your burden.

If you are going for graduation at the age of more or less 20 years, better to go with regular mode, and leave the mode of distance for them, who are already in job and want to improve or upgrade their education. It matters much. Regards.
